ABSTRACT
The immune system is designed to protect an organism from infection and damage caused by a pathogen. A successful immune response requires the coordinated function of multiple cell types and molecules in the innate and adaptive immune systems. Given the complexity of the immune system, it would be advantageous to build computational models to better understand immune responses and develop models to better guide the design of immunotherapies. Often, researchers with strong quantitative backgrounds do not have formal training in immunology. Therefore, the goal of this review article is to provide a brief primer on cellular immunology that is geared for computational modelers.
